Need to focus on mechs that will bring something to the game we don't have yet...

Javelin - Inner Sphere light that jumps and can bring 12 SRMs of pain? Sure.
Assassin - Inner Sphere could use another 40 ton mech, and the Assassin brings almost Spider like mobility.
Viper/Dragonfly - Fast, medium-weight jumper for the clans.
Shadowcat - Fast, mid-weight clan mech with MASC. Also a fan favorite.
Kingfisher - Fills in the vacant 90 ton weight class for the clans. Also gives us a clan mech with a standard engine, no cries of P2W here.
Executioner/Gladiator - Fast clan assault with MASC and jump jets, also fills in the 95 ton weight class.

Crusher Joe and Fangs of the Sun trademarks expired which is why we see those mechs in the game now. Harmony Gold (or whoever) still protects / pays for whatever the trademarks on Macross/Robotech.

http://www.sarna.net/wiki/Unseen

Unless there is an agreement with PGI we'll probably never see: Wasp Stinger Valkyrie Phoenix Hawk Crusader Rifleman Archer (sad face)
Warhammer Longbow Marauder (sad face) Marauder II
